Struct screeps::objects::StructurePowerSpawn
source · pub struct StructurePowerSpawn { /* private fields */ }
Expand description
An object representing a StructurePowerSpawn
, which can process
power to contribute to your GPL as well as renewing power creeps.

sourcepub fn process_power(&self) -> Result<(), ErrorCode>
pub fn process_power(&self) -> Result<(), ErrorCode>
Process power, consuming 1 power and POWER_SPAWN_ENERGY_RATIO
energy
and increasing your GPL by one point.

sourcepub fn js_pos(&self) -> RoomPosition
pub fn js_pos(&self) -> RoomPosition
Gets the RoomPosition
of an object, which is a reference to an
object in the javascript heap. In most cases, you’ll likely want a
native Position
instead of using this function (see
HasPosition::pos
), there may be cases where this can provide
some slight performance benefits due to reducing object churn in the js
heap, so this is kept public.

sourcepub fn as_string(&self) -> Option<String>
Available on crate feature std
only.
pub fn as_string(&self) -> Option<String>
std
only.If this JS value is a string value, this function copies the JS string
value into wasm linear memory, encoded as UTF-8, and returns it as a
Rust String
.
To avoid the copying and re-encoding, consider the
JsString::try_from()
function from js-sys
instead.
If this JS value is not an instance of a string or if it’s not valid
utf-8 then this returns None
.
§UTF-16 vs UTF-8
JavaScript strings in general are encoded as UTF-16, but Rust strings
are encoded as UTF-8. This can cause the Rust string to look a bit
different than the JS string sometimes. For more details see the
documentation about the str
type which contains a few
caveats about the encodings.
